China Gold International Resources Corp Ltd leverages China National Gold's engineering, operating, and financing capabilities globally.
China National Gold, a Chinese state owned enterprise and the largest gold producer in China owns approximately 39.3% of China Gold International Resources Corp Ltd outstanding shares and continues to demonstrate its commitment to China Gold International Resources Corp Ltd.
